Description
A delicious and cheesy dish featuring zucchini layered with three types of cheese, perfect for a comforting meal.
Ingredients

- 2 medium zucchinis, sliced
- 1 cup ricotta cheese
- 1 cup m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
- 1 egg
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up marinara sauce
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a bowl, mix ricotta cheese, egg,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
- In a baking dish, spread a layer of marinara sauce on the bottom.
- Layer half of the zucchini slices over the sauce.
- Spread half of the ricotta mixture over the zucchini.
- Sprinkle half of the mozzarella and Parmesan cheese over the ricotta layer.
- Repeat the layers with the remaining zucchini, ricotta mixture, and cheeses.
- Top with the remaining marinara sauce and a sprinkle of mozzarella and Parmesan.
- Bake for 30-35 minutes until bubbly and golden.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
- For a spicier version, add red pepper flakes to the marinara sauce.
- Feel free to substitute other vegetables like eggplant or bell peppers.
- This dish can be made ahead of time and reheated before serving.
